One of hubby and I’s favorite snack. Inspired by 2 dishes we loved from restaurants. The Steak bites served with sesame sauce at Canadian Brewhouse in Canada are awesome, one of their best sellers!
These Szchewan Beans we used to eat at Milestones in Alberta. We just loved them. Although they are not on the menu anymore. Costco Canada now actually sells a szchewan green bean kit to make these, they aren’t bad!
Steak bites. Marinated in soya sauce for a couple hours. Then put your favorite steak spice on them.
These beans, I could eat this whole pan lol!
The green beans I put them in that pan just covered with water and boil til almost cooked. I drain water. And add about 2TBSP of this sauce. I make this sauce ahead this stores in my fridge til needed.
1TSP Szchewan peppercorns
1/4CUP soy sauce
3TBSP honey
1TBSP sesame oil
1TBSP rice wine vinegar
1TBSP Chinese cooking wine or mirin
3 garlic cloves, finely minced
2TSP fresh ginger, finely minced
1TBSP garlic chili paste more for more spicy or 1TSP chili flakes
1/2TSP Chinese five spice

When I buy my meat at the grocery store before freezing it I prepare and or add some things to it before freezing.
This was a pack of chicken thighs. Skin on and bone in. I added some curry, chili powder, tumeric, onions & mushrooms some oil to mix it all around til well incorporated. I had put in freezer bag and froze.
Add the thawed chicken mixture to a hot cauldron with the oil & butter added. Cook til thigh skins are nicely browned.

When thighs are browned. I add everything else. 8cups chicken stock, lots of cut up onions, carrots cut in big pieces, peas, garlic, couple TBSP curry & Thai Chilis. Boil for an hour or more. This smells incredible and tastes as good as it looks! Serve with some rice.

Jalapeno Cheddar Dutch Oven Bread

Jalapeno Cheddar Dutch Oven Bread » RecipeCollage.com » October 6, 2024
Basic 4 ingredient white bread, recipe makes 2 loaves.
3 cups water lukewarm
1 1/2TBSP active dry yeast
1 1/2TBSP salt
6 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
In a bowl add the warm water, salt and yeast stir.
In another bowl add flour & salt, then pour the yeast mixture over the flour and mix with wooden spoon.
Place the dough in a large container, and cover well. but do not close completely, there needs to be one corner left open to let the gases escape.
Let the dough rise for 2 hours up to 18hours.
The dough will be very sticky and elastic.
Add flour to your hands, and divide the dough in two pieces. Add more flour to your hands as necessary. Shape the dough into the desired shape for your bread and place it seam down in a hot Dutch oven. Sprinkle some more flour on top of the loaves. Let the loaves rest for another 30 minutes so that they can rise a bit.
Preheat oven to 450 F degrees.
Bake the bread for 30covered then about 8-12minutes uncovered til browned and crisp
Cool on a rack.

Jalapeno Cheddar loaf
add half cup grated cheddar & 1 cut cubed jalapenos to your flour/salt at the beginning of recipe. I top with a couple of jalapenos and cheddar before it goes in oven.
